The opposite of "constant" is "variable." While something constant remains unchanged over time, a variable is subject to change and can take on different values or forms. This distinction is important in various fields, such as mathematics and science, where constants provide stability and variables introduce flexibility.

Yes, "fickle" is often considered the opposite of "constant." While "fickle" describes someone or something that is changeable, inconsistent, or unreliable, "constant" refers to something that remains the same or is steadfast over time. Thus, the two terms highlight contrasting qualities regarding stability and reliability.
